Stonerose Interpretive Center Eocene Fossil Site
Stonerose Interpretive Center Eocene Fossil Site is a museum in Ferry, Washington.| Tap on a place to explore it |
- Opening hours: Friday—Monday 10:00 AM—2:00 PM
- Type: Museum
- Also known as: “Stonerose Interpretive Center”

Republic is a small city in the Rocky Mountain foothills of northeast Washington State. It is the county seat of Ferry County.
